**Q: Where do contractors sign in during the Fennick Row renovation?**

A: The main entrance is closed. Use the temporary site office in the rear car park, open 07:00–17:00 weekdays. Hi-vis and boots required beyond the hoarding. The site office door has a keypad; enter using the code below.

door code, yagap-bahof: bdg-O-05

**Alert: StoneLoom incremental rebuild lag**

This fires when incremental static rebuilds on StoneLoom take longer than 10 minutes. Usually it's the asset diffing cache going stale — clearing it and re-triggering the build fixes 90% of cases. If it keeps firing, the content graph may be corrupted; don't rebuild from scratch without checking first. Future maintainers: questions about this alert go here.

escalation mailbox, bafog-fafog: ulador@paliqlabs.internal

Several external plugin authors have reported that uploads to the SproutCycle scheduler marketplace fail with SIGNATURE_MISMATCH since the 3.2 rollout. Investigation shows our verifier now requires manifests signed against the updated trust root, while older tooling still references the retired chain. Please re-sign your plugin bundles before resubmitting; unsigned or legacy-signed packages will be rejected automatically. For convenience during the transition, the current marketplace signing key is included below.

signing key of fajof-tagag = bky3_rJk